The decision to implement workplace drug testing goes beyond compliance. It’s about creating a safer work environment, protecting your business from liability, and making informed hiring decisions. In industries such as construction, transportation, and manufacturing, prevalent throughout Athens and Oconee County, the stakes are particularly high for workplace safety.

Georgia employers have the legal right to conduct drug testing as part of their hiring and employment practices. While Georgia law doesn’t mandate drug testing for most private employers, many choose to implement testing programs to qualify for workers’ compensation premium discounts of up to 7.5%². For businesses operating in DOT-regulated industries, drug testing isn’t optional; it’s a federal requirement that must be followed precisely to maintain compliance.

Beyond legal and financial considerations, drug testing helps employers build stronger teams. Pre-employment screening ensures you’re bringing reliable, safety-conscious individuals into your organization. Random testing programs help maintain workplace standards, while post-accident testing provides crucial information for incident investigations and workers’ compensation claims. Pre-Employment Drug Testing is the most common type of occupational screening. This testing occurs after a conditional job offer has been made and helps employers verify that new hires meet the company’s drug-free workplace standards. DOT vs. Non-DOT Drug Testing: Understanding the Difference

Step-by-step process for occupational drug screening at an urgent care clinic

One of the most common questions we receive from employers involves the distinction between DOT and non-DOT drug testing. Understanding these differences is crucial for compliance, especially for companies in transportation, construction, and other regulated industries throughout Athens and Oconee County.

DOT Drug Testing follows strict federal regulations established by the Department of Transportation. These regulations apply to safety-sensitive employees in industries including trucking, aviation, railroads, transit, pipelines, and maritime operations. DOT testing must use a specific 5-panel test that screens for marijuana, cocaine, amphetamines, opioids, and phencyclidine (PCP). The collection process follows rigid chain-of-custody procedures, and DOT-certified collectors must conduct all testing at approved facilities⁴.

Non-DOT Drug Testing offers more flexibility for employers not subject to federal transportation regulations. Companies can choose from various panel options, including 5-panel, 10-panel, or customized testing that screens for specific substances of concern. Non-DOT testing can be tailored to your industry, workplace risks, and company policies. Many Athens and Oconee County employers opt for 10-panel testing, which includes the standard 5-panel drugs plus additional substances like benzodiazepines, barbiturates, methadone, propoxyphene, and methaqualone.
